It is often transmitted via body fluids like blood, … Web20 okt. 2024 · Hepatitis B virus (HBV) infection is the major infectious hazard for health-care personnel. During 1993, an estimated 1,450 workers became infected through exposure to blood and serum-derived body fluids, a 90% decrease from the number estimated to have been thus infected during 1985 (18-20).

WebHepatitis B is a serious disease caused by a virus that attacks the liver. The hepatitis B virus (HBV) can cause lifelong infection, cirrhosis (scarring) of the liver, liver cancer, liver failure, and death. A vaccine is available to prevent this infection. WebHepatitis A virus detection: - highlighting acute-phase anti-HAV IgM antibodies by ELISA method (transaminases go up as well); acute-phase antibodies appear from the debut and last for about 10 weeks; - after 10 weeks: anti-HAV IgG that lasts until the end of life, their presence reflecting either disease or vaccine.

WebThe hepatitis virus panel is a series of blood tests used to detect current or past infection by hepatitis A, hepatitis B, or hepatitis C. It can screen blood samples for more than one kind of hepatitis virus at the same time. Antibody and antigen tests can detect each of the different hepatitis viruses.
